Andy Farrell and New Zealand’s Ireland tour: “It’s completely different”

Andy FarrellAfter the 40-man squad was confirmed, the tour was buzzing with what it would hold. Ireland By New Zealand In the July window, he will play five games: three against All blacks and the remaining two in front Maori All Blacks.

Head coach Clover He analyzed what the tour would be like: “Any good performance you’ve seen in the last two years, we have to be better than that. It’s different and that’s why tours are important for these guys,” he said.

At the same time, Farrell And: “We’ve got guys with 20+ caps who’ve never toured. Walking around Auckland, Wellington or Dunedin isn’t the same as walking around Ballsbridge (the area of ​​Dublin where the Aviva Stadium is). What good are you,” he commented.

Finally, the trainer Ireland He left a big pre-trip message: “It’s totally different; This is real international rugby and that’s what we want at the moment. We’re very excited to be taking this team to a very tough place in World Rugby to find out about ourselves.”
